2009-03-02 77 views
1

我网站上的一个页面非常高。它的大小不到200KB,但它是一系列需要很大垂直空间的表格。在大约40个屏幕截图(大约是网页总滚动高度的1/4)之后,它只是停止绘图:以上所有内容看起来都很好,而且下面的所有内容都是纯白色背景 - 除了页脚(在不同的div中,I猜测),在底部显示正常。Firefox中的长页面被截断

我已经问过办公室了,其他人以前也见过这个,但不知道是什么原因造成的。我们当然在这里有其他网页,一样高,没有问题。我已经看到网页呈现很好,这是更长的时间。它根本不是一个复杂的文档 - 一些嵌套的div,一些表格(4或5列,每行数百行),一些CSS。

该页面在IE7和Chrome中均呈现出色。只有Firefox 3才能做到这一点。

任何线索是什么造成的?还是解决方法?我甚至不知道在这里谷歌。

编辑:我在另一个完全无关的页面上看到了这个。在这两种情况下,它都会从top-ha的33000 px处切断。我知道FF3可以有比这更长的div和表格。有人知道他们可能使用16位大小/坐标吗?

+0

也许问自己为什么你一次向用户显示那么多的数据?谁需要,一次能够消耗多少数据? – Malfist 2009-03-02 18:48:42

+0

@Malfist:那不是重点,不是吗? – 2009-03-02 18:58:24

+0

不完全,但这就是为什么我没有发布它作为答案。但它仍然是一个有效的点。 – Malfist 2009-03-02 19:03:13

回答

2

听起来这可能与Firefox Bug 215055Firefox Bug 333994。检查出来。如果它确实是相关的,那么你总是可以将你的测试用例附加到这些bug中的一个,并将你的评论添加到bug中。

我也推荐像zodeus那样尝试每晚构建或测试3.1。如果它在那里得到修复,那并不意味着你强迫你的客户进行升级,但至少你知道它在未来的版本中已经修复,你可以为Mozilla.org进行宣传,将修复带回到一个更新的版本,你可能会得到人们升级。

0

尝试下载Fire Fox 3.1 Beta或Nightly Build。他们重做了很多内部。如果它在那里工作,那么我会说这是一个报告和固定的FF3.0错误。在Bugzilla的申请

0

This错误可能与...